This rosé seduces with a cool nose that combines herbs, sponge cake, and the tangy freshness of red currants. A hint of pomegranate and tart citrus, especially mandarin, harmoniously rounds off the bouquet. Be captivated by the vibrant fruitiness, which presents fresh strawberries and mint in perfect balance. The seemingly elegant body impresses with a firm structure and lively freshness, while the subtle tartness on the palate ensures a delightful drinking experience. The finish unfolds with increasing fruit sweetness, accompanied by a subtle caramel note and fresh herbs – a pleasure you shouldn't miss. Spreitzer

VDP Member Estate

The German winery Spreitzer from the Rheingau was founded as early as 1641 and is today owned by Andreas and Bernd Spreitzer. It is located directly on the Rhine, not far from the cities of Mainz and Wiesbaden, and has a total vineyard area of 30 ha, which is distributed over four sites. Among the best sites of the winery are Oestricher Lenchen and Doosberg. A special feature of the winery is the vaulted cellar from the year 1745, in which the produced wines are stored. The soils of the sites consist of loess loam, marl, and partly of quartzite and offer the vines, due to the proximity to the Rhine, an excellent water supply. At Weingut Spreitzer, 97% of the Riesling grape variety is grown and only a small percentage of Pinot Noir. In total, the winery produces and sells approximately 160,000 bottles of wine.
